Rise of the Tomb Raider 2016 release windows announced for PC, PS4

Rise of the Tomb Raider will remain an Xbox console exclusive for one year, Square Enix has announced.

After almost a year of not knowing the terms of the exclusivity period, Square has revealed release windows for the PC and PlayStation 4 versions of the game.

Microsoft is publishing the Crystal Dynamics title on Xbox consoles, along with providing hardware-specific development support.

Rise of the Tomb Raider's Xbox exclusivity period was announced during gamescom 2014.

Since the announcement, Square Enix has reiterated more than once the exclusivity period "had a duration."

Today, it was announced the latest game in the franchise will be made available for Windows 10 and Steam in early 2016.

PlayStation 4 users can purchase the game during Holiday 2016.

Rise of the Tomb Raider will be released on Xbox 360 and Xbox One November 10.
